I am getting frustrated trying to design a logo for my company. It is taking me longer to launch my website because of it. Should I have a professional handle the logo for me or should I just throw up something I am not satisfied with?
Answer
If you’re asking this question, 99% of the time you should hire someone.
By asking this question you show that at least one (likely all of) the following are true:
- You care about the design enough to want it to be done very well (as you should).
- You don’t feel very confident in your own ability to create a great logo.
- You don’t have a very clear goal in mind and could use some more thought on the subject.
- You don’t have the know how or time to carry out your idea in a way that creates the logo at a high quality.
If two of them are true (I sure hope the first one is), you should hire someone to do it for you. That doesn’t mean you pay someone $5 to do it either, you need to pay someone who actually knows that they’re doing or else they won’t be of a help to you at all, which means it may cost little more than what you’re wanting to pay. A good logo is hard work and takes a lot of thought and effort. Compensation has to cover that.
